Key Points:

  • In 2026, travelers prioritize meaningful, experience-driven trips over frequent travel, focusing on cultural events like the Winter Olympics and World Cup, as well as nature and personalized comfort.
  • Kayak reports a 9% rise in early travel searches with falling airfare making international trips more accessible, especially to Eastern Europe, which is gaining popularity for its culture and affordability.
  • Luxury travel shifts toward personalization and authentic connections, with affluent travelers valuing seamless service and meaningful moments over traditional status symbols, according to Capital One.
  • Trends from platforms like Airbnb and Expedia highlight short, intense getaways, nature-focused escapes, and event-driven travel, with Gen Z leading interest in viral destinations and high-energy cultural experiences.
